Is the Real Alcázar Worth It? And How Long You Need

Updated September 19, 2026

Carved plaster arches and the upper gallery around the Patio de las Doncellas
Photo: Andbog, CC BY-SA 4.0

Yes. For most visitors the Real Alcázar is the single best thing to see in Seville, and at €15.50 it is one of the better-value monuments in Spain. Plan two to three hours for the palaces and gardens, and book an entry time in advance.

Why it is worth it

  • It is still a royal palace. The upper floor is the Spanish royal family's residence when they stay in Seville.
  • The Mudéjar palace is unique. Built for King Pedro I in the 14th century by craftsmen trained in Islamic traditions, it has the carved plaster, tiled walls and courtyards people usually travel to Granada to see, in the middle of a city.
  • The gardens are half the visit. Terraces, pools, orange trees, a maze and long shaded galleries. Many visitors spend as long outside as inside.
  • It is a UNESCO World Heritage Site, listed in 1987 together with the Cathedral and the Archivo de Indias.

Who might skip it

  • You are in Seville for half a day and have already booked the Alhambra. The two are related in style; if time is very short, choose one.
  • You cannot get an entry time and do not want a tour. Turning up without a ticket in high season rarely works. See what to do if tickets are sold out.
  • Midday in July or August can be exhausting, because much of the visit is outdoors. Go at opening time or late afternoon instead.

How long do you need?

Visit Time
Quick walk through the main palaces 1 – 1.5 hours
Palaces and gardens at a relaxed pace 2 – 3 hours
With the Upper Royal Quarters add 30 – 45 minutes
Guided tour about 1 hour for the guided part, then stay as long as you like

Arrive at least two hours before closing time (19:00 in summer, 17:00 in winter). See opening hours.

Guided tour or on your own?

On your own is fine if you like to wander and read. A guide is worth it if you want the stories: who built what, and why a Christian king built a palace that looks Islamic.
